Vegan BBQ Jackfruit Lettuce Tacos (Printable)

Smoky jackfruit in crisp lettuce with a creamy tangy slaw and fresh cilantro garnish.

# What you'll need:

→ BBQ Jackfruit

01 - 2 cans (14 oz each) young green jackfruit in brine, drained and rinsed
02 - 2 tablespoons olive oil
03 - 1 small red onion, finely diced
04 - 3 garlic cloves, minced
05 - 1 cup vegan BBQ sauce
06 - 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
07 - 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
08 - Salt and pepper to taste

→ Creamy Slaw

09 - 2 cups shredded green cabbage
10 - 1 cup shredded purple cabbage
11 - 1 medium carrot, julienned
12 - 1/4 cup thinly sliced green onions
13 - 1/4 cup vegan mayonnaise
14 - 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
15 - 1 teaspoon maple syrup
16 - Salt and pepper to taste

→ Assembly

17 - 8 large butter lettuce leaves or romaine hearts
18 - Fresh cilantro leaves for garnish
19 - Lime wedges

# Method:

01 - Combine shredded green cabbage, purple cabbage, julienned carrot, and sliced green onions in a large bowl. In a separate small bowl, whisk vegan m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, maple syrup, salt, and pepper until smooth. Pour dressing over vegetables and toss until evenly coated. Refrigerate until ready to serve.
02 - Drain and rinse canned jackfruit thoroughly. Using your hands or two forks, shred the jackfruit pieces into tender strands, removing any hard cores or seeds.
03 -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add diced red onion and sauté for 3 to 4 minutes until softened. Add minced garlic and cook for 1 minute longer until fragrant.
04 - Add shredded jackfruit, smoked paprika, ground cumin, salt, and pepper to the skillet. Stir continuously for 2 minutes to evenly coat the jackfruit with spices.
05 - Pour vegan BBQ sauce into the skillet and reduce heat to low. Simmer uncovered for 10 to 12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until jackfruit becomes tender and sauce thickens slightly.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
06 - Place a generous spoonful of BBQ jackfruit into each lettuce leaf. Top with creamy slaw, garnish with fresh cilantro leaves, and serve with lime wedges on the side.

02 -
  • Don't skip the rinsing step with canned jackfruit—this is where most people run into that metallic, tinny aftertaste that makes them swear jackfruit doesn't work.
  • The slaw actually improves after a few hours in the fridge as the dressing softens the cabbage slightly, so you can make it earlier in the day if you're prepping ahead.
  • If your BBQ sauce is very thin, the simmering time might need to extend to 15 minutes—you want the sauce to coat the jackfruit, not pool at the bottom of the pan.
03 -
  • A dash of liquid smoke stirred into the jackfruit at the very end adds an almost smoky-grill depth that makes people ask what your secret is.
  • If you want extra creaminess in the slaw, replace half the vegan mayo with cashew cream—it's richer and adds a subtle nuttiness.
